I want to change the resolution on my monitor but it only has one button which is to power it off so I don’t know how to change it.

1 REPLY 1
HP Recommended

Welcome to the HP User to User forum.

With so little information, there is only a limited way to help.  But most times the resolution is adjusted in Windows, assuming the PC is running Windows.

Right click on a blank area on the desktop and pick "Display settings", then resolution.  Resolution should allow the changing of the monitor settings.

For any additional help please post the model number of the PC, the model number of the monitor, and the OS name and version running on the PC
